Understanding Preventative Maintenance
Preventative maintenance involves regularly inspecting, servicing, and replacing pump components before problems occur. By identifying potential issues early, businesses can avoid sudden equipment failures. For pumps, this includes checking mechanical seals, bearings, gaskets, valves, and other critical components that are prone to wear.
Benefits of Preventative Maintenance
Reduced Downtime
One of the most immediate advantages of preventative maintenance is the reduction of unexpected downtime. By scheduling regular inspections and servicing, potential faults can be addressed before they lead to pump failure. This keeps production lines moving and prevents costly interruptions.
Extended Equipment Life
Regular maintenance helps extend the operational life of pumps. Mechanical seals, for example, can be refurbished or replaced during maintenance cycles, preventing premature wear and costly replacements. Lubrication, cleaning, and calibration of components ensure the pump operates efficiently over time.
Improved Safety and Compliance
In industries like pharmaceuticals and food processing, maintaining equipment in optimal condition is not only about efficiency but also safety and regulatory compliance. Preventative maintenance ensures pumps operate correctly, reducing the risk of leaks, contamination, or operational hazards.
Cost Savings
Investing in preventative maintenance is often more cost-effective than dealing with emergency repairs. By addressing minor issues early, companies can avoid major breakdowns and reduce the need for expensive replacements. This approach also improves resource planning and budgeting for maintenance activities.
